How Old Is Maxwell’s Coffee?

Introduced in 1892 by wholesale grocer joel owsley cheek, it was named in honor of the maxwell house hotel in Nashville, Tennessee, which was its first major customer. What Is A Biscoff Made Of?

wheat flour, Sugar, vegetable oils (contains one or more of soybean oil, sunflower oil, canola oil, palm oil), Brown sugar syrup, Sodium bicarbonate (leavening), Soy flour, Salt, Cinnamon. What Does A Coffee Trader Do?

In this role, your job duties focus on finding quality coffee beans from reputable sources, negotiating a price with the producer, and developing relationships with farmers and distributors Before making a buying decision, you must also assess shipping and distribution costs and other variables.
